Mid spetember freeze hit one of my feilds this fall, just happened to be my last planted corn, 85 day, was just starting to dent, but not evenly through the feild. Took off about 7 acres of it in different parts of the feild. First gravity wagon 18% moisture and 48# test weight. Actually vloumn wise seemed to be yeilding pretty good. This is that feild that I dealt with the spongy cobs and losing corn out the back, and the head. Frustrating. Everything else so far is coming in 14-15% and 57-59 TW. Whats the best thing to do with all that lighter weight corn? about 30 acres over there, half should be in that 160 bu range(although weight wise will factor less). Blend it, feed it?
